A good, creepy mystery/ghost story. Disappointingly, I never found it terrifying, but it was definitely creepy. I like how everything tied together and I thought the ending was perfect. The Iceland setting also added an interesting element.

The last 30% of this book was excellent - it just took far too long for the story to come together and pick up momentum!
It is also translated from another language, so the slow burn felt even more slow when combined with some odd sentence structure.
If you’ve ever wondered if books could scare you - i know realize it all depends on your level of self control and patience. I have the tendency to be impatient and visually jump to the punchline of a chapter, which ruined the author’s intent at pacing. My fault, not hers!

Closer to a 3.5, some spooky stuff for sure. I wonder how much nuance was missed in translation. There were a few plot points that I predicted by the middle. Maybe the dash of foreign novelty since I’m not very familiar with Icelandic culture made up for that. Definitely have a blanket near while you read, you may need I for a few reasons.
